As the conversation continues, they talk about the internalised messages and societal pressure that can make it difficult to celebrate our achievements. Despite the impulse to downplay, it’s important to acknowledge and enjoy our accomplishments without attaching them to further success.

There’s an extra dose of cosmic in this episode thanks to the recent astrological blue moon, which is when two full moons occur during the same sign, and to celebrate Mads and Ellen are also doubling up with two listener questions!

 

Listener Question 1
The first question comes from someone with a gift for amplifying other people and helping them achieve things who asks: “If it is part of my design to bring out the good in others, why am I jealous of the person I helped?”

Ellen brings up that someone asking you for help suggests that you’re really capable in that area. If jealousy comes up, it might be because you aren’t using your gifts in the way you’d like to. Mads shares her experience of launching others toward their goals but feeling left behind. It was only when she used those feelings as a guide that she was able to find the path that made her happy.

 

Listener Question 2
The second listener says: “I'd like to hear what or where you think the power can be in the concept of surrendering in any area of life, work, relationships, et cetera. What does it look like to surrender?”

Ellen admits she struggles with the idea of surrendering, and that childbirth is the only time she’s actually experienced it. Even after that experience, she finds it difficult to cultivate the immense trust surrender requires, and the idea of fully losing control is nerve-wracking. 

In contrast, Mads views surrender as a beautiful, freeing process. She makes a distinction between surrendering due to exhaustion and the more powerful intentional surrender that flows with life’s momentum.
